I love this Montauk Twill Jacket in Ivory from Talbot’s

I will be able to do so much with it, but today’s look is very different for me….yet, I am so glad I tried it.

I have seen many women wearing cream on white or white on cream, and it was Annie Castano’s inspiration that gave me courage to style this.

It is at the moment one of my favorite looks in my wardrobe.  I would not have had the courage to do this without seeing others wearing this new take of neutral on neutral.

This jacket is available in four lovely shades including a bright orangey papaya color. 

But, the cream filled a need in my wardrobe after I sent my white jackets on their merry way. 

And Talbot’s offers a matching Pima Cotton-Blend Tank in Ivory

Their ivory color is a rich, buttercream-like color…just lovely.

I know regular readers are well aware that I love these a.n.a. High Rise Jeggings from JCP.

Not only does this outfit speak to my style adjectives of joyful, approachable, creative/artistic, polished, and current; but it also keeps me well within warm colors.

I can still wear white/white as long as it is not up against my face.

Favorite Spring Jackets

I decided to pop color with my favorite spring jacket with a gorgeous Echo Silk Scarf from Dillard’s.

It was made to go with one of my older, bolder Chico’s necklaces and vintage Chico’s bracelet with orange beads. 

I like the way the brown in the necklace matches the buttons on the jacket, and the necklace is made with ivory, green, brown and gold beads.

I just love an outfit made up of pieces that seem made to go together.
